资源简介:
Single-cell RNA sequencing of immune cells of mouse spinal cord using Drop-Seq Overall design: Drop-Seq was performed for spinal cord immnue cells dissociated from ambisextrous C57BL/6J mice after spinal cord injury at 0, 3, and 14 day-post injury (dpi). Single-cell suspensions derived from heathy spinal cords were generated using the ActD-based protocol or standard dissociation protocol. Single-cell suspensions dissociated from injured spinal cords were generated only using the ActD-based protocol. Drop-Seq was used to produce single-cell cDNA libraries attached to microbeads. cDNAs were amplified by PCR and prepared for sequencing.
